Ok. There are several unmerged PRs addressing java compatibility that have been around for over a year without attention. Unfortunately, I don't think me creating another PR is going to help.
This one, in particular, seems to provided everything needed: https://github.com/mojohaus/aspectj-maven-plugin/pull/45 A separate fork has even been published to maven central based on this change... com.nickwongdev:aspectj-maven-plugin. My company has been using that fork for a while now, but we'd like to move back to the "official" plugin. David has been unresponsive for over a year, so if anybody on this list could help, I think the community would appreciate it very much (See all the thumbs-up reactions on that PR). No offense to David, but I think expecting David to continue maintenance at this point is not a good strategy. On Sat, Jan 18, 2020 at 9:21 AM Anders Hammar <[email protected]> wrote: > Ok, we're not really looking for "temporary" maintainers. In that case you > should create PRs. > > I file your pain though. I think the best approach is if you could provide > a good PR and then ping us here to take a look. Hopefully david could spare > a few cycles or someone else. > > /Anders > > On Sat, Jan 18, 2020 at 6:14 PM Phil Clay <[email protected]> wrote: > >> Thanks Anders >> >> Yes, I'm interested. At least temporarily, to get aspect-maven-plugin >> working with the latest releases of java, and building in ci (since the >> latest builds are failing on travis). We'll see how that goes, and how >> much future time I have to dedicate to it. >> >> Here is my github profile: https://github.com/philsttr >> >> I'm the active maintainer of >> https://github.com/logstash/logstash-logback-encoder, where I manage >> issues/PRs, publish releases, respond to stackoverflow questions, and >> actively develop. >> >> I also occasionally contribute to other projects. Some recent PRs: >> https://github.com/spring-projects/spring-security/pull/7756 >> https://github.com/apache/maven-deploy-plugin/pull/9 >> https://github.com/testcontainers/testcontainers-java/pull/1833 >> >> Let me know if there is anything else you need from me, and what the next >> steps are. >> >> Phil >> >> >> On Sat, Jan 18, 2020 at 6:30 AM Anders Hammar <[email protected]> wrote: >> >>> That's absolutely possible. We don't have any strict guidelines for this >>> process though. >>> >>> But if you're interested you could state this together with some track >>> record, like pull requests. >>> >>> /Anders >>> >>> On Thu, Jan 16, 2020 at 11:17 PM Phil Clay <[email protected]> wrote: >>> >>>> Is there any way for an interested person to become a maintainer of the >>>> aspectj-maven-plugin, since @davidkarlsen appears to no longer be >>>> maintaining it? >>>> >>>> I'm assuming someone in the mojohaus github organization would have >>>> access to the aspectj-maven-plugin repository to grant someone access. >>>> >>>> >>>> On Monday, January 13, 2020 at 11:21:34 PM UTC-8, Anders Hammar wrote: >>>>> >>>>> My guess is that nobody with interest in that plugin has had time to >>>>> look into it. Some of our mojos are just maintained by a single developer >>>>> and hence the activity is low. The aspectj mojo hasn't had a commit for >>>>> almost two years now and seems to be one of those unfortunately. >>>>> >>>>> /Anders >>>>> >>>>> On Mon, Jan 13, 2020 at 4:41 PM 'Alexander Bubenchikov' via >>>>> mojohaus-dev <[email protected]> wrote: >>>>> >>>>>> Hi all >>>>>> >>>>>> I Just wanted to now, what is the current status of >>>>>> aspectj-maven-plugin? >>>>>> >>>>>> I see pull request >>>>>> https://github.com/mojohaus/aspectj-maven-plugin/pull/45 to support >>>>>> java 11, it is marked as green, have more that 20 votes, but not merged >>>>>> still. >>>>>> >>>>>> Is there any issue in this PR, or aspectj-maven-plugin is not >>>>>> supported now, or just nobody had enough time to look into it? >>>>>> >>>>>> Thanks, Alexander >>>>>> >>>>>> -- >>>>>> You received this message because you are subscribed to the Google >>>>>> Groups "mojohaus-dev" group. >>>>>> To unsubscribe from this group and stop receiving emails from it, >>>>>> send an email to [email protected]. >>>>>> To view this discussion on the web visit >>>>>> https://groups.google.com/d/msgid/mojohaus-dev/e1ba990a-21b5-433f-8858-494b4903696d%40googlegroups.com >>>>>> <https://groups.google.com/d/msgid/mojohaus-dev/e1ba990a-21b5-433f-8858-494b4903696d%40googlegroups.com?utm_medium=email&utm_source=footer> >>>>>> . >>>>>> >>>>> -- >>>> You received this message because you are subscribed to the Google >>>> Groups "mojohaus-dev" group. >>>> To unsubscribe from this group and stop receiving emails from it, send >>>> an email to [email protected]. >>>> To view this discussion on the web visit >>>> https://groups.google.com/d/msgid/mojohaus-dev/90736979-2f12-4c3c-a3c7-cfcc927ef2e0%40googlegroups.com >>>> <https://groups.google.com/d/msgid/mojohaus-dev/90736979-2f12-4c3c-a3c7-cfcc927ef2e0%40googlegroups.com?utm_medium=email&utm_source=footer> >>>> . >>>> >>> -- >>> You received this message because you are subscribed to the Google >>> Groups "mojohaus-dev" group. >>> To unsubscribe from this group and stop receiving emails from it, send >>> an email to [email protected]. >>> To view this discussion on the web visit >>> https://groups.google.com/d/msgid/mojohaus-dev/CAKDUN1vPSsfpUijM3a8SXFxKLdZxqkui3TW09R_WMBQzuJiiQg%40mail.gmail.com >>> <https://groups.google.com/d/msgid/mojohaus-dev/CAKDUN1vPSsfpUijM3a8SXFxKLdZxqkui3TW09R_WMBQzuJiiQg%40mail.gmail.com?utm_medium=email&utm_source=footer> >>> . >>> >> -- >> You received this message because you are subscribed to the Google Groups >> "mojohaus-dev"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to [email protected]. >> To view this discussion on the web visit >> https://groups.google.com/d/msgid/mojohaus-dev/CAKBvkK-2qpbPNSZ4gQR6kBooNkSuHXF-qvQa%3DBR22zN37a%3Dh%3DA%40mail.gmail.com >> <https://groups.google.com/d/msgid/mojohaus-dev/CAKBvkK-2qpbPNSZ4gQR6kBooNkSuHXF-qvQa%3DBR22zN37a%3Dh%3DA%40mail.gmail.com?utm_medium=email&utm_source=footer> >> . >> > -- > You received this message because you are subscribed to the Google Groups > "mojohaus-dev" group. > To unsubscribe from this group and stop receiving emails from it, send an > email to [email protected]. > To view this discussion on the web visit > https://groups.google.com/d/msgid/mojohaus-dev/CAKDUN1v3QmNnSknGwZOWSEQ2BG81tZzM0yk5CaQpXrk2c4s1vg%40mail.gmail.com > <https://groups.google.com/d/msgid/mojohaus-dev/CAKDUN1v3QmNnSknGwZOWSEQ2BG81tZzM0yk5CaQpXrk2c4s1vg%40mail.gmail.com?utm_medium=email&utm_source=footer> > . > -- You received this message because you are subscribed to the Google Groups "mojohaus-dev"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. To view this discussion on the web visit https://groups.google.com/d/msgid/mojohaus-dev/CAKBvkK__w6fnbrT7pbUZUCU6CtWssXjhzPGz5agCnf%2B6ihByxQ%40mail.gmail.com.
